Getting there & planning your visit

To visit Clapper bridge approximately 20 metres east of Fountaines Hospital, the nearest railway station is Embsay, located 9.5 km away. The postcode for navigation is BD23 5HH, and entry to the site is free.

Heritage listing

Details This list entry was subject to a Minor Amendment on 28 November 2025 to correct a typo in the description and to reformat the text to current standards SD 9862-9962 12/63 LINTON MAIN STREET (south side, off) Clapper bridge approximately 20 metres east of Fountaine's Hospital. 10.9.54 GV II Pedestrian bridge over Linton Beck. Probably C17 or earlier, repaired mid C20. Gritstone. Two piers of rubble stone and roughly-shaped blocks support three flat stone slabs, the outer ends of which apparently rest only on the bank. Insensitively repaired with concrete; wood and iron railings. Possibly erected to allow access from Fountaines Hospital to the village of Thorpe and Burnsall beyond.
